Hyderabad, May 2 -- Greater Hyderabad Municipal Corporation (GHMC) has collected a record Rs 900.93 crore in property tax for the financial year 2025-26 through its Early Bird Scheme, outshining themselves with last year's collection of Rs 831.23 crore.

The civic body has witnessed a significant increase in membership in the Early Bird Scheme this year, with 7,93,552 property holders taking advantage of the scheme. The scheme provides a 5 percent discount on the advance property tax amount if paid in its entirety by April 30.
